Located in one of Western Australia's most historically significant and vibrant regional centres, this 200+ bed public hospital is a key healthcare provider for the the region. The facility is classified as a Level 1 hospital, offering a full spectrum of medical and surgical services, and is undergoing continued development to enhance specialist care access in remote WA. The Obstetrics & Gynaecology department provides a wide range of services including antenatal care, intrapartum care, gynaecological surgery, and outreach clinics. With approximately 500 births annually, the unit maintains a strong focus on collaborative, patient-centred care. The department is also accredited by RANZCOG for training, contributing to the next generation of O&G professionals. The Opportunity In this role, you will join a collegiate team of paediatric specialists providing high-quality care across inpatient, outpatient, emergency, and community settings. The service has: A Level 4 Obstetrics unit with approximately 430 births annually A Level 3 Special Care Nursery Around 650 general paediatric admissions per year Over 16,000 ED presentations, with around 25% being paediatric cases A well-established community paediatric clinic running five days per week Outreach consulting services provided to surrounding areas You’ll work alongside up to four Consultant Paediatricians, a Paediatric Registrar (Advanced Trainee), and a HMO, with strong links to regional referral services.
